Join us for a fun and entertaining look back at ten years of Grateful Crane.

For the past ten years, the Grateful Crane Ensemble, a non-profit theater group based in Los Angeles, has been presenting educational and theatrical programs in appreciation for the unique hardships and inspiring contributions of Japanese Americans in our country's history. Grateful Crane shows such as The Camp Dance: The Music & The Memories and Nihonmachi: The Place to Be have told our stories, and featured popular Japanese and American songs such as "Koko ni Sachi Ari," "Ue o Muite Arukou," "Kawa no Nagare no Youni," "Stardust," "Moonlight Serenade" and "Boogie Woogie Bugle Boy." Each of these songs and more will be presented in "The Best of Grateful Crane" show.

Sponsored by Grateful Crane Ensemble, Hiroshi & Sadako Kashiwagi, Tak & Terry Kosakura, Naomi Suenaka, Tomiye Sumner, FIA Insurance Services, Fukui Mortuary, Hiroshi F. Kashiwagi, Soji & Keiko Kashiwagi, Masayo Nishikawa and the Orange County Buddhist Church.

Donation: $50.00. 100% of ticket proceeds will benefit the Northern Japan Earthquake Relief Fund, which has raised nearly $1.6 million for non-profit and community service organizations in Japan that have been providing citizen relief efforts for those most in need.
